#e2ad3c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e2ad3c is composed of 88.6% red, 67.8%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.5% magenta, 73.5%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 40.8 degrees, a saturation of 74.1% and a lightness of 56.1%. #e2ad3c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ff78 with #c55b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#e2ad3c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e2ad3c has RGB values of R:226, G:173,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.73,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14855484.

Shades and Tints of #e2ad3c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0701 is the darkest color, while #fefc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e2ad3c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#94918a is the less saturated color, while #fcb622 is the most saturated one.
